From: Thomas Huth Date: Fri, 10 Apr 2026 15:46:37 +0000 (+0200) Subject: efi/capsule-loader: fix incorrect sizeof in phys array reallocation X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=48a428215782321b56956974f23593e40ce84b7a;p=thirdparty%2Fkernel%2Flinux.git efi/capsule-loader: fix incorrect sizeof in phys array reallocation The krealloc() call for cap_info->phys in __efi_capsule_setup_info() uses sizeof(phys_addr_t *) instead of sizeof(phys_addr_t), which might be causing an undersized allocation. The allocation is also inconsistent with the initial array allocation in efi_capsule_open() that allocates one entry with sizeof(phys_addr_t), and the efi_capsule_write() function that stores phys_addr_t values (not pointers) via page_to_phys(). On 64-bit systems where sizeof(phys_addr_t) == sizeof(phys_addr_t *), this goes unnoticed. On 32-bit systems with PAE where phys_addr_t is 64-bit but pointers are 32-bit, this allocates half the required space, which might lead to a heap buffer overflow when storing physical addresses. This is similar to the bug fixed in commit fccfa646ef36 ("efi/capsule-loader: fix incorrect allocation size") which fixed the same issue at the initial allocation site.
